I cannot find any documentation for the KAddressBook program.
STEPS TO REPRODUCE
1. I invoke Kaddressbook, either from the start menu, or from a command line,
or from the "TOOLS" menu in KMail. I click on "Help", then "KAddressBook
Handbook". The KDE HelpCenter program starts, and dislays this screen:
Documentation not Found
Jack Ostroff <ostroffjh at users.sourceforge.net>
Revision Frameworks 5.0 (2014-04-02)
The requested documentation was not found on your computer.
The documentation may not exist, or it may not have been installed with the
application.
2. So I chase the link to KDE Documentation (https://docs.kde.org/index.php)
and put "KAddressBook" in the search box. I receive this response:
The application KAddressBook could not be found. Please check if you entered
the name correctly, or use the navigation on the left to access the complete
KDE User Documentation.
3. So I try the "Kontact" Handbook, either via the "Help Center" locally, or
via the KDE documentation site, and I open that. So far, so good. I go to
Chapter 2, "Kontact Components", and click the link to "KAddressBook", the KDE
contact manager. Same thing: "Documentation Not Found".
4. I even visit http://userbase.kde.org/, where I do find some sketchy
documentation. I guess I'll rely on that.
OBSERVED RESULT
No Documentation Found
EXPECTED RESULT
The KAddressBook Handbook (a .pdf file)
